在当今数字化时代,企业级云服务和容器技术已经成为推动业务创新和效率提升的关键力量。阿里云作为中国领先的云服务提供商,其P8和K8s架构的融合更是备受瞩目。本文将深入解析阿里云P8与K8s架构,探讨它们如何实现企业级云服务与容器技术的完美融合。
阿里云P8架构概述
1. P8的背景与设计理念
阿里云P8架构是阿里云自主研发的企业级云服务架构,旨在为用户提供高性能、高可靠、易扩展的云服务。P8架构的设计理念包括:
- 模块化设计:将云服务拆分为多个模块,便于管理和扩展。
- 弹性伸缩:根据业务需求自动调整资源,实现高效利用。
- 高可用性:通过冗余设计,确保服务稳定可靠。
2. P8架构的核心组件
- 计算节点:负责执行业务逻辑,提供计算能力。
- 存储节点:负责存储和管理数据。
- 网络节点:负责数据传输和负载均衡。
- 管理节点:负责监控、管理和维护整个云服务。
K8s架构解析
1. K8s的起源与发展
Kubernetes(简称K8s)是由Google开源的容器编排平台,旨在简化容器化应用程序的部署、扩展和管理。K8s自2014年开源以来,已成为容器编排领域的标准。
2. K8s的核心概念
- Pod:K8s的最小部署单元,包含一组容器。
- Node:K8s的工作节点,负责运行Pod。
- Master:K8s的主节点,负责集群的管理和控制。
- Controller:K8s的控制器,负责维护集群的状态。
阿里云P8与K8s的融合
1. 融合背景
阿里云P8与K8s的融合,旨在为用户提供更高效、更稳定的云服务。通过将K8s集成到P8架构中,可以实现以下优势:
- 简化部署:用户可以轻松地将应用程序部署到阿里云P8平台上,无需关心底层基础设施。
- 弹性伸缩:K8s的弹性伸缩能力与P8架构相结合,实现资源的高效利用。
- 高可用性:P8架构的冗余设计结合K8s的故障转移机制,确保服务稳定可靠。
2. 融合实现
- P8集群管理:P8架构负责管理K8s集群,包括节点管理、资源分配等。
- K8s容器编排:K8s负责容器化应用程序的部署、扩展和管理。
- 服务发现与负载均衡:P8架构提供服务发现和负载均衡功能,确保应用程序的高可用性。
总结
阿里云P8与K8s架构的融合,为企业级云服务与容器技术的结合提供了有力支持。通过这种融合,用户可以享受到更高效、更稳定的云服务,推动业务创新和效率提升。未来,随着容器技术的不断发展,阿里云P8与K8s的融合将更加深入,为用户带来更多价值。
